About the Comprehensive Cancer Control Program
An integrated and coordinated approach to reduce the incidence and mortality of cancer by preventing it, finding it early, treating it and caring for those who have it is the approach by the ODH Cancer Program.
Several programs in the department work together with partners outside ODH to reduce the burden of cancer in many ways.
We want to help Ohioans know more about cancer and how to prevent it, find it early and get treatment if needed. Working with the American Cancer Society, information is shared through printed materials on television and radio, and by collaborating with partners such as Ohio’s various medical schools, health professionals and other groups.
By working together, we truly will make a difference in the health and quality of life in our state.
